What started with a simple ball of yarn has woven together an entire community of transformation. In a culture where women rarely leave their homes, a knitting project has become a lifeline of hope, dignity, and newfound independence for Roma women who had never before earned their own income.
These talented artisans, who learned knitting at their mothers’ knees, are now turning their traditional skills into financial freedom. But the real magic happens during their bi-weekly gatherings, where needles click and lives change. Here, women who once rarely left their homes find friendship, support, and vital knowledge about health, education, and community development.
The ripple effects touch every generation. As mothers gain confidence and income, their children see new possibilities for their own futures. What began as a simple knitting circle has grown into a comprehensive program supporting school children and vulnerable youth throughout the community.
